Overview

Founded in 1997 and headquartered in Nuremberg, Germany, Paessler AG is a recognized name in the network monitoring industry and the developer of PRTG Network Monitor. Built around a "sensor" model, Paessler offers 500+ pre-built sensor types covering network devices, servers, applications, storage, virtualization, and traffic analysis, with over 500,000 deployments worldwide.

Paessler's core philosophy is to simplify network monitoring: administrators install the PRTG core service on Windows Server, and the system automatically discovers network devices and recommends sensor configurations. The free edition supports 100 sensors with no time limit, giving small networks a zero-cost starting point. After nearly 30 years of iteration, Paessler serves education, healthcare, government, and manufacturing, from SMBs to large enterprises and MSPs.

Product Ecosystem

Sensor Architecture

PRTG is designed around the "sensor" concept: each sensor monitors one specific metric—the Ping sensor checks device reachability, the CPU Load sensor tracks server CPU utilization, and the HTTP sensor monitors website response time. Sensors support batch creation, grouping, and inherited configuration for flexible monitoring hierarchies.

Alerting & Notifications

PRTG supports email, SMS, HTTP requests, and push notifications. Thresholds can be set at the sensor or group level with escalation chains—unresolved issues are automatically promoted to higher-priority notifications. For complex scenarios, PRTG supports combined alert triggering based on multiple sensor states.

Traffic Analysis & Bandwidth Monitoring

PRTG integrates NetFlow and sFlow analyzers to collect traffic data directly from network devices, displaying real-time bandwidth utilization, top talkers, and application protocol identification. For deep bandwidth monitoring, PRTG provides out-of-the-box traffic dashboards without third-party tools, combinable with log analysis to identify traffic anomaly root causes.

Distributed Monitoring & Remote Probes

In multi-site scenarios, PRTG's Remote Probe architecture lets you install probe agents at remote sites that transmit data through encrypted channels to the headquarters core service. Connections between probes and the core service support local caching and resumable transfer, ensuring monitoring data is never lost during unstable network conditions.

Limitations

  • Windows-Only Deployment: The PRTG core service must run on Windows Server, which is unfriendly to Linux-centric operations teams and adds Windows licensing and security maintenance overhead.
  • High Cost at Scale: Enterprise licensing is tiered by sensor count (500, 1,000, 2,500, unlimited). Beyond 5,000 sensors, annual licensing can reach tens of thousands of dollars. Evaluate open-source options such as Zabbix for large-scale needs.
  • Single-Server Bottleneck: PRTG centers on a single Windows Server. Beyond 1,000 sensors, CPU and memory usage rises significantly, requiring Remote Probe distribution and adding maintenance complexity.
  • Limited Alert Flexibility: Alert conditions are primarily threshold-based (above/below X) without native regex or compound cross-sensor logic; complex alerting requires custom scripts.

Use Cases

  • Small to Mid-Size IT Environments (★★★★★): 100–500 sensors covering network devices and servers, fast deployment, and low operational overhead. The free edition meets basic small-office needs.
  • Bandwidth & Traffic Analysis (★★★★): Native NetFlow/sFlow capabilities excel for ISP and enterprise IDC egress monitoring as a cost-effective alternative to dedicated tools.
  • Education & Healthcare Networks (★★★★): The free edition covers campus and hospital network basics, with 500+ sensors for most IT assets.
  • Large-Scale Distributed Monitoring (★★): Sensor counts and licensing costs limit scalability; beyond 10,000 sensors consider Prometheus or Zabbix.

Pricing

Edition Price Highlights
PRTG Freeware Free 100 sensors, full features, no time limit
PRTG 500 $1,750/yr 500 sensors, includes 1-year maintenance
PRTG 1000 $3,400/yr 1,000 sensors, includes 1-year maintenance
PRTG 2500 $7,250/yr 2,500 sensors, includes 1-year maintenance
PRTG Unlimited $15,500/yr Unlimited sensors, includes SLA support

Note: Prices are official list prices as of August 2026 and may vary by region and channel. A 30-day fully featured trial is available.
